Maintaining healthy blood sugar levels is crucial for overall well-being, especially for individuals diagnosed with prediabetes or diabetes. One key measure of long-term blood sugar control is the A1C test, which provides an average blood sugar level over the past two to three months. Understanding how to lower a1c naturally
A1C, also known as HbA1c, measures the percentage of hemoglobin in the blood that is coated with sugar (glycated). A higher A1C indicates higher blood sugar levels and an increased risk of complications related to diabetes. Diet Adjustments of lower a1c naturally
One of the most effective ways to lower your A1C naturally is through dietary changes:
Low Glycemic Index Foods
Consuming foods with a low glycemic index (GI) can help regulate blood sugar levels. These foods are absorbed more slowly and cause a gradual rise in blood sugar. Examples include whole grains, legumes, vegetables, and most fruits.
Fiber-Rich Diet
Incorporating high-fiber foods into your meals can stabilize blood sugar levels. Fiber slows down the absorption of sugar, preventing spikes. Aim to include vegetables, fruits, nuts, seeds, and whole grains in your diet.
Balanced Meals
Ensure your meals are balanced with proteins, healthy fats, and carbohydrates. This balance helps maintain steady blood sugar levels throughout the day.
Physical Activity
Regular exercise is another crucial factor in lowering A1C levels:
Aerobic Exercise
Engaging in aerobic activities like walking, jogging, cycling, or swimming for at least 150 minutes a week can significantly improve blood sugar control.
Strength Training
Incorporating strength training exercises twice a week can enhance insulin sensitivity, allowing your body to use sugar more effectively.
Consistency
Maintaining a consistent exercise routine is key to achieving and sustaining lower A1C levels.
Weight Management
Achieving and maintaining a healthy weight is important for blood sugar control. Even a modest weight loss can have a significant impact on lowering A1C levels. Combining a healthy diet with regular physical activity can help achieve this goal.
Stress Reduction
Chronic stress can negatively affect blood sugar levels. Techniques such as mindfulness, meditation, deep breathing exercises, and yoga can help reduce stress and improve overall health.
Sleep Quality
Quality sleep is often overlooked but is vital for blood sugar regulation. Aim for 7-9 hours of uninterrupted sleep per night to support your body’s natural processes and help lower your A1C.
How to Lower A1C Overnight?
While it’s unrealistic to expect drastic changes in A1C levels overnight, some strategies can help improve blood sugar levels quickly:
Hydration
Staying well-hydrated can help your kidneys flush out excess sugar through urine.
Healthy Snacking
Opt for healthy snacks like nuts, seeds, or a small piece of fruit to avoid blood sugar spikes.
